The Champions League semi-final between Paris Saint-Germain and FC Bayern Munich on Tuesday produced a ratings record, with the spectacular match setting a new best in the streaming space. Over five million households tuned in according to broadcaster Prime Video – more than ever before for a sports eveng on the platform.
Based on the industry standard of at least 1.6 people per household, this means that over eight million football fans watched the thrilling clash live on their screens. The first leg of the semi-final thus surpassed the previous viewership record in Germany, set just a few weeks ago. The first leg of the quarter-final between FC Bayern and Real Madrid on April 7 2026 had held the top spot with more than 4.5 million households tuning in.
